Concept

The public sector Request for Proposal (RFP) process represents a complex operational system designed to achieve multiple, often competing, objectives. It is an architecture of rules and procedures intended to secure goods and services that deliver maximum public value. This system is engineered to ensure fairness in competition, maintain transparency in the expenditure of public funds, and remain compliant with a dense web of legal and regulatory frameworks.

Legal challenges are not external attacks on this system; they are manifestations of the inherent stresses and friction points within its design. These challenges arise when the procedural machinery fails to perfectly align with the core principles it is meant to uphold, creating vulnerabilities that can be contested.

Understanding these legal challenges requires a perspective that views the RFP not as a simple procurement transaction, but as a formal, evidence-based dialogue between a public entity and potential suppliers. Every step, from the initial drafting of the solicitation to the final contract award, is a recorded action within this dialogue. A legal challenge is fundamentally an argument that a specific action or decision within this process was inconsistent with the established rules of communication ▴ the laws, regulations, and the RFP’s own terms. These rules govern how the public entity must articulate its needs, how it must evaluate the responses it receives, and the degree of transparency it must provide to all participants.

The core of the issue lies in the translation of abstract legal mandates into concrete operational practice. Mandates for “fairness,” for instance, must be translated into specific, objective, and consistently applied evaluation criteria. The requirement for “transparency” must be balanced against the need to protect confidential commercial information.

When this translation is imprecise or its application is flawed, the system’s integrity is compromised, opening the door to legal disputes. These disputes, therefore, serve as a critical, albeit adversarial, feedback mechanism, highlighting areas where the operational execution of the procurement process has diverged from its foundational legal and ethical principles.


Strategy

A strategic analysis of legal challenges in public sector RFPs moves beyond a simple cataloging of problems. It involves systematically deconstructing the procurement lifecycle to identify and categorize vulnerabilities. These challenges are not random events; they cluster around specific phases of the RFP process where ambiguity, subjectivity, or procedural missteps are most likely to occur. By mapping these risk zones, public entities and bidders can develop proactive strategies to reinforce the integrity of the procurement architecture.

A primary source of legal friction stems from the failure to align the detailed specifications of an RFP with the overarching evaluation criteria, creating a disconnect that invites challenges.

Systemic Vulnerabilities in Procurement Architecture

Legal challenges can be broadly classified into three systemic domains. Each domain represents a fundamental component of the procurement system where a failure to adhere to governing principles can trigger a formal dispute, such as a bid protest.

  • Specification and Scoping Integrity ▴ This domain concerns the initial definition of the public entity’s requirements. Challenges here often arise from specifications that are either overly restrictive, effectively pre-selecting a favored vendor, or so vague that they prevent bidders from preparing responsive proposals. A lack of clarity in the scope of work can lead to misinterpretations and, subsequently, allegations that the winning bidder’s proposal was non-compliant with the actual needs of the agency.
  • Evaluation and Award Protocol ▴ This is the most fertile ground for legal disputes. These challenges focus on the process by which the public entity assesses proposals against the criteria laid out in the RFP. Issues include the inconsistent application of scoring methodologies, the introduction of unstated evaluation criteria, or clear mathematical errors in scoring. A common allegation is that the evaluation was not conducted with the objectivity promised in the solicitation documents.
  • Procedural and Transparency Compliance ▴ This domain covers the administrative and communicative aspects of the RFP process. Challenges can be based on missed deadlines, improper communication with bidders (creating an appearance of bias), or a failure to properly document the evaluation process. A lack of transparency in explaining the award decision is a frequent point of contention, leaving losing bidders to suspect that the process was arbitrary or unfair.

Mapping Challenge Types to Procurement Phases

The likelihood of specific legal challenges shifts as the RFP process unfolds. A granular understanding of this progression allows for the targeted allocation of legal and compliance resources. The table below illustrates this dynamic relationship.

Table 1 ▴ Probability of Legal Challenges Across RFP Phases
Procurement Phase Primary Legal Challenge Category Illustrative Pitfall Legal Principle at Stake
RFP Drafting & Publication Specification and Scoping Integrity Drafting overly restrictive specifications that favor a single vendor. Fair and Open Competition
Bidder Q&A Period Procedural and Transparency Compliance Providing substantive information to one bidder without issuing a formal addendum to all. Equal Access to Information
Proposal Submission & Opening Procedural and Transparency Compliance Mishandling of late submissions or failure to maintain confidentiality of proposals. Due Process and Confidentiality
Evaluation Committee Scoring Evaluation and Award Protocol Evaluators applying personal biases or unstated criteria to score proposals. Objectivity and Impartiality
Contract Award & Debriefing Evaluation and Award Protocol Providing a debriefing that fails to adequately explain the weaknesses of the losing proposal. Transparency and Accountability

Strategic Mitigation through Systemic Reinforcement

Mitigating these legal risks requires a strategic approach focused on strengthening the internal mechanics of the procurement system. This involves developing robust templates for solicitation documents that mandate clarity in scope and evaluation criteria. It necessitates rigorous training for evaluation committee members on the principles of objective scoring and the avoidance of bias.

Furthermore, implementing a standardized and well-documented communication protocol for all interactions with bidders can neutralize allegations of improper influence. Ultimately, the strategy is one of prevention, building a procurement process so clear, consistent, and well-documented that it becomes inherently defensible against legal challenges.


Execution

The execution of a legally resilient public sector RFP process is a matter of operational discipline. It translates strategic principles into a series of concrete actions, checklists, and documentation standards that are embedded into the procurement workflow. This operational playbook is designed to minimize ambiguity and subjectivity, thereby reducing the surface area for potential legal challenges. The focus is on creating a clear, auditable trail that demonstrates adherence to the principles of fairness, transparency, and objectivity at every stage.

A defensible award decision is the direct result of a meticulously executed and documented evaluation process, where every scoring judgment is tied to specific evidence within the proposal.

The Operational Playbook for Risk Mitigation

A robust RFP process can be operationalized through a series of phase-specific protocols. These protocols function as internal controls designed to preempt the most common legal failures.

Phase 1 ▴ Solicitation Architecture

  1. Requirement Validation ▴ Before drafting begins, all technical specifications and performance requirements must be reviewed by a cross-functional team, including legal counsel, to ensure they are performance-based and non-restrictive. The objective is to define the “what,” not the “who” or “how.”
  2. Evaluation Matrix Construction ▴ The evaluation criteria must be finalized and weighted before the RFP is released. Each criterion should be broken down into objective, measurable elements. For example, a criterion for “Past Performance” should specify the number and type of references required.
  3. Document Review Protocol ▴ A final pre-publication review must be conducted by someone not involved in the drafting process to check for internal contradictions, ambiguities, or language that could be perceived as biased.

Phase 2 ▴ Conduct and Communication

  • Centralized Communication Channel ▴ All communications with potential bidders must be routed through a single point of contact, typically the procurement officer. All substantive questions must be answered via formal, numbered addenda distributed to all registered bidders to ensure equal access to information.
  • Pre-Proposal Conference Discipline ▴ If a pre-proposal conference is held, the agenda must be strictly followed. All questions and answers from the conference must be documented and distributed in a formal addendum.
  • Confidentiality Assurance ▴ Strict protocols must be in place to ensure the security and confidentiality of submitted proposals before the official opening, preventing any claims of tampering or premature disclosure.

Quantitative Modeling of Protest Risk

While legal risk can never be eliminated, it can be modeled. A risk matrix helps procurement teams to visualize and prioritize their mitigation efforts. This model forces a quantitative assessment of both the likelihood and the potential impact of different legal challenges, moving risk management from a subjective exercise to a data-informed discipline.

Table 2 ▴ Bid Protest Risk Assessment Matrix
Grounds for Protest Likelihood (1-5) Impact (1-5) Risk Score (Likelihood x Impact) Primary Mitigation Action
Unduly Restrictive Specifications 3 5 15 Mandatory review of specifications by independent technical and legal experts.
Flawed Evaluation/Scoring 4 5 20 Rigorous training for all evaluators; detailed scoring rubrics; independent audit of final scores.
Unequal Treatment of Bidders 2 5 10 Strict adherence to centralized communication protocols; documentation of all bidder interactions.
Failure to Follow Stated Evaluation Criteria 4 4 16 Pre-evaluation briefing with the committee to review and confirm understanding of the exact criteria and weighting.
Misrepresentation by Awardee 2 3 6 Thorough responsibility determination and reference checks before contract award.

Predictive Scenario Analysis a Case Study in Evaluation Failure

Consider a municipal government issuing an RFP for a new city-wide IT infrastructure management system. The RFP correctly states that proposals will be scored on three criteria ▴ Technical Solution (40%), Cost (30%), and Past Performance (30%). Vendor A proposes a state-of-the-art technical solution at a high cost, with excellent references from large corporations. Vendor B offers a less advanced, but fully compliant, solution at a significantly lower cost, with solid references from other municipalities.

During the evaluation, one influential committee member, an IT director with a background in corporate technology, becomes a powerful advocate for Vendor A’s superior technology. This member’s enthusiasm sways the committee, which gives Vendor A a perfect score on the Technical Solution. To justify the award, the committee inflates Vendor A’s Past Performance score, reasoning that its corporate experience is “more complex” than Vendor B’s municipal experience, even though the RFP did not make this distinction. Vendor A is awarded the contract.

Vendor B, upon receiving a debriefing, requests the scoring sheets. The documentation reveals the inconsistent application of the Past Performance criteria and the subjective preference for “advanced” technology that was not explicitly requested or defined as a scoring factor. Vendor B files a bid protest on two grounds ▴ failure to follow the stated evaluation criteria and the introduction of unstated criteria (a preference for corporate over municipal experience). A court or administrative body would likely find the protest valid.

The procurement process was tainted by the subjective bias of the evaluation committee, which failed to adhere to the objective framework it had promised to use. The result is a costly legal battle, a delay in the project, and a loss of trust in the municipality’s procurement process. The contract award is overturned, and the entire RFP must be re-issued, wasting months of work and significant public resources.

A System of Integrity

Viewing legal challenges as failures of a complex system, rather than as isolated disputes, shifts the entire operational perspective. The integrity of a public procurement decision is a direct output of the integrity of the process that created it. The documentation, the scoring rubrics, the communication logs ▴ these are not administrative burdens.

They are the structural components of a defensible system. The ultimate goal is to build a procurement architecture so robust and transparent that its outcomes are seen as the logical, inevitable result of a fair and well-executed process, rendering most challenges moot before they are ever contemplated.
